Mission

Our mission at Justice Revival is to inspire, educate, and mobilize Christian communities to respond faithfully to the call to justice by standing in solidarity with the oppressed and defending the human rights of all.

Human Rights Education

Justice Revival helps faith leaders and communities understand human rights more deeply, through innovative, religiously literate education programs offered online and through our seminary partners. Our
flagship, church-based course has served hundreds of participants nationwide. Through sermons, lectures, and publications, we bring a thoughtful, well-informed voice of faith to justice issues of our day, emphasizing support for human rights in the Christian tradition.

Justice Revival marshals intellectual, cultural, and spiritual resources of Christian faith communities to advocate boldly for equal justice and rights for all. We engage our community in advocating with and for those facing threats to their dignity and rights in collaboration with diverse religious, interfaith, and secular
partners. Our advocacy efforts focus on racial and gender justice, while supporting the liberation struggles of religious minorities, migrants, low-income families and, others whose rights are under threat.

Justice Revival is a leading, national voice advocating for equal rights and full inclusion of all people in our nation’s constitution. As the creator and convener of the #Faith4ERA campaign, we have engaged hundreds of interfaith leaders across the country in calling for adoption of the Equal Rights Amendment to
the U.S. Constitution.
